Meanwhile I have kicked the second run outside to play under the sun for a month. I moved back in to their old veg tent the midgets and a misfit. A Humboldt OG (HOG) stayed in and will flip with these. I am using 14/10 to move the sunrise and sunset to align with the other tent, and run at night when the air is cooler, and to have the tent elec load opposite time of the AC load..

The plant I call "?" because I lost track of the genetics at the right rear. Trying to pull down the two main branches they split at the split. The plant is a beast. Serious Kush left rear, Gelato x Dosidios x OPG rt front, and the HOG left front. I will not use nets here, but maybe some bamboo sticks if needed. The outsiders got a lot taller and bushier under old Sol. I dread the stretch, but there is room.

7 plants out of 8 of this run finish, and the Sundae Stallion is outside with the second run, still alive but no home. With two Strawberry Bananas coming, that little plant is unwanted and unloved.

Click image for larger version  Name:	DSC00524.JPG Views:	0 Size:	81.5 KB ID:	17847592

So the plan is:

* Big tent - flower till around 6/1 and chop.

* Little tent - flower till 7/1 and chop. Then start vegging sativas in there (that will be run three).

* Second run outsiders come back inside and go in the big tent 6/1 and flower there until 8/1 then chop. Put the sativas in there to flower when then 2nd run is done.

And so on, and on to the 4th run. What this means is I will need more big jars with a harvest coming in once a month for the next three months. Gonna have too much dope.
